Lots of flies are jigs, in essence,  all the bead heads and cone heads and dumbbell eyed  stuff act as jigs and many of them are even tied on jig hooks. And if your jig is tied on a single point hook, in Mo. it is legally a fly in fly fishing only waters. So put them with the rest of the flies. Not so many flies today have spinners on them as there were back 60-70 years ago, but Pistol Petes are still fairly common. 

If you want to do a bunch of hand carved plugs or molded stuff  and lures with multipoint and/or multiple   hooks, those as "not legally flies" might need a special place, but to me a lure is lure.  Almost anything that is not "bait" is a lure.
